Techniques of Sedation Dentistry



Discovering the numerous techniques of sedation dentistry can considerably improve your oral experience. You'll locate that different techniques accommodate your one-of-a-kind needs and convenience levels.

One common method is marginal sedation, where you're wide awake however unwinded, often attained through laughing gas, additionally referred to as laughing gas. This approach permits you to remain tranquil during treatments while still being alert adequate to react to your dental expert.

Modest sedation, on the other hand, might entail dental sedatives, making you sluggish but not totally subconscious. This alternative can be perfect for longer treatments or if you're especially distressed.

For those requiring deeper sedation, intravenous (IV) sedation is readily available. It delivers sedatives directly into your blood stream, enabling an extra profound state of relaxation.

Benefits of Sedation Dentistry



Sedation dentistry supplies numerous advantages that can make your dental brows through extra enjoyable and convenient. One of the major benefits is anxiousness reduction. If you have a tendency to really feel anxious or scared about dental treatments, sedation can help you relax, allowing the dental professional to do required therapies without interruptions.

In addition, sedation can enhance your general convenience during longer procedures. You won't have to withstand any discomfort or discomfort, making the experience much more manageable. This convenience can also result in an extra efficient consultation, as your dental expert can finish numerous treatments in one see without you feeling bewildered.

Sedation dentistry can additionally improve your participation throughout visits. When you're unwinded, you're much less most likely to fidget or respond negatively to the treatment, which assists your dental practitioner job better.

Lastly, many individuals report having bit to no memory of the treatment, which can be a significant relief if you fear concerning dental work. What to Expect During Therapy



When you show up for your sedation dental care visit, the process will begin with a thorough consultation to review your case history and any type of problems you might have. This step makes sure that the sedation technique selected is safe and efficient for you.

Your dental professional will certainly discuss the treatment and address any kind of inquiries to assist you really feel comfy.

Next, you'll receive the sedation, which could be laughing gas, oral sedatives, or IV sedation, depending upon your requirements. You'll really feel loosened up and comfortable, enabling your dental professional to do the needed treatments without discomfort.

During the procedure, you may really feel drowsy or even sleep, yet you'll still be closely kept an eye on by the oral group. They'll ensure your vital indicators remain stable throughout the treatment.

As soon as the procedure is total, you'll be required to a healing area where you can relax up until the sedation diminishes.
